Sourcing from Central and Eastern Europe: a tier base built around anchor assembly plants

What this answers

How do we win capacity in a Central and Eastern European supply base that is already committed to anchor customers?

The supplier base across Central and Eastern Europe grew for a specific purpose: to feed the assembly plants that were established there. That origin explains its shape today — heavy in metalworking, machining, moulding, wire harnessing and electronics assembly, organised around the process families those anchor customers need, and holding capacity that is largely already spoken for. A buyer arriving from outside is entering an established tier structure rather than an open market.

A tier structure, not an open market

Suppliers in the region typically sit in a defined position beneath one or more large assembly operations, with volumes, schedules and quality expectations set by those relationships. That has shaped their equipment choices, their documentation practice and their tolerance for schedule volatility. The advantage for a new buyer is a base already trained to demanding automotive-derived disciplines. The difficulty is that the anchor customer's programme has priority over yours in the schedule, in engineering attention and in capital allocation, and no contract you sign will fully change that ordering. Understanding where a supplier sits in that structure tells you more about its behaviour than its certificate list does.

Toolrooms and engineering that came with the industry

Tool and die making, jig and fixture work, and machine shop capability developed alongside the assembly plants, and the resulting engineering depth is one of the region's real strengths. Suppliers can generally build and maintain their own tooling, propose manufacturability changes, and take a design from drawing to validated process without external help. For a buyer this shortens development and removes a whole category of sub-tier coordination. It also means tooling questions are discussed technically rather than commercially, and a supplier will usually tell you plainly when a design will not run.

Labour availability has replaced labour cost as the constraint

The original attraction of the region was an available industrial workforce. Across much of it, the binding limit is now finding and keeping people rather than what they cost, with plants in the same industrial area competing for the same operators, toolmakers and quality technicians. That constraint shows up as reluctance to take on labour-intensive work, as automation investment, and as a preference for programmes that run steadily rather than in bursts. Enquiries that require a step change in headcount are less likely to be accepted than ones that fit existing manning.

One regulatory frame, many commercial cultures

Suppliers across the region operate under a shared European regulatory and standards environment, which makes conformity, substance declarations and market placement straightforward for a European buyer. Commercial practice is not uniform: negotiation style, contract expectations, payment culture, holiday shutdown patterns and the language used on the shop floor differ appreciably between countries and between an internationally owned plant and a locally owned one. Assume the regulatory work transfers between suppliers and the relationship work does not, and budget the second accordingly. Internationally owned plants in the region often run parent-company procedures that differ from local practice next door, so verify rather than generalise from one supplier to the next.

Making your programme worth a slot

Because capacity is committed, award decisions are made partly on whether your work fits what the shop already does well. Programmes that use existing equipment, run in predictable volumes and require no new hiring get attention. Those that need a new process, a new machine or a new team are assessed as investments and will be priced and scheduled as such. Being explicit about volume stability, forecast reliability and the length of commitment you can offer moves a supplier further than a target price does, particularly when the anchor customer offers neither.

Frequently asked questions

How does an anchor customer's demand affect our deliveries?
Directly, and usually invisibly until it bites. When the anchor programme calls off more than planned, your work moves down the schedule, engineering support is redirected and change requests slow. Contractual remedies exist but rarely restore the sequence in time to help. The practical protections are choosing a supplier where you represent a meaningful share of the plant's output rather than a rounding error, understanding which shift and which machines your part runs on, and holding enough cover to absorb a displaced week.
Is the region a like-for-like alternative to sourcing from further afield?
It differs in kind rather than being a straight substitute. What it offers is a short physical replenishment loop within a shared regulatory space, engineering and toolroom capability on site, and documentation practice that a European customer will recognise. What it does not offer is deep low-cost assembly labour or the component ecosystem density found in the largest export bases. Categories requiring heavy manual assembly or a broad local component tier often do not fit; machined, formed and tooled parts frequently do.
What should we look at when auditing a supplier in the region?
Beyond the usual process and system evidence, examine capacity honestly: which machines are genuinely free, what the anchor customer's committed volume consumes, and what the manning plan looks like on the shift your part would run. Look at staff turnover and at the toolroom, since both predict how the relationship will perform under pressure. Ask what the supplier declined recently and why, which is often the most informative answer you will get about where its real constraints sit.
